Fostering a love of reading for success
The Ottawa Citizen
Re: Ontario’s children drastically losing love of reading, study finds, Dec. 13.
This article highlights a disturbing trend among Ontario children.
There should be no blame or finger pointing in responding to this wake up call, but rather we should see this as an early warning sign that in our efforts to raise test scores we should never take the fun and the sheer pleasure of reading out of the equation.
There is no question that our kids need all the skills in the tool kit to lead productive and happy lives and there is no question that the love of reading is the bedrock upon which all our efforts must be based.
If children do not have healthy and active imaginations, if they are insecure about expressing themselves or believing in themselves, which a love of reading fosters, then they will always be disadvantaged.
As the study by The People for Education shows, “students’ reading enjoyment contributes to their success in all subjects, as well as their sense of social and civic engagement.”
We have seen first-hand the amazing impact meeting an author can have in a child’s life.
Ottawa International Writers Festival, Fall Edition
| October 20, 2011 | to | October 25, 2011 |

Canada’s Festival of Ideas since 1997. The Writers Festival celebrates the world’s best writing from home and abroad with a diverse program that presents interactions with leaders in the worlds of science, history, poetry, politics, spoken word, economics, drama, fiction, biography, music and more. Since 2004 the Festival has consisted of two annual Editions: Spring and Fall.
As reported in the Ottawa Xpress, “Basically, if you’ve thought about it, The Writers Festival has invited someone to discuss it.”
